How much do design system man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 14, 2026, the average yearly pay for design system manager in Colorado is $107,325.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$81,000.00 and $131,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Design System Manager vs UX Designer?

AspectDesign System ManagerUX Designer
CredentialsBachelor's in Design, Human-Computer Interaction, or related field; experience with design systemsBachelor's in Design, Psychology, or related field; portfolio showcasing user-centered designs
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with product teams, developers, and designers to maintain design systemsFocuses on user research, wireframing, prototyping, and user testing
Industry UsageCommon in organizations with large design teams and complex product ecosystemsUsed across various industries to improve user experience and interface design

The Design System Manager primarily oversees the development and maintenance of design systems, ensuring consistency across products. In contrast, UX Designers focus on creating user-centered designs through research and prototyping. While both roles require design knowledge, the Design System Manager emphasizes system-wide consistency, whereas UX Designers prioritize user experience and interaction design.

How does a Design System Manager typically collaborate with product teams and developers?

A Design System Manager works closely with product teams, UX/UI designers, and developers to ensure consistency and efficiency across all digital products. They facilitate cross-functional communication by gathering feedback, aligning design standards with engineering requirements, and providing clear documentation. Regular sync meetings, design reviews, and collaborative workshops are common, allowing the manager to address challenges and promote adoption of the system. This collaboration helps streamline workflows, resolve discrepancies, and maintain a cohesive user experience across platforms.

What is a Design System Manager?

A Design System Manager is a professional responsible for creating, maintaining, and evolving an organization's design system. This role ensures consistency in visual styles, components, and user experience across all digital products. Design System Managers collaborate with designers, developers, and product teams to implement best practices, document guidelines, and manage updates to the system. Their work helps streamline workflows, improve accessibility, and foster a cohesive brand identity.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Design System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Design System Manager, you need expertise in UI/UX design principles, front-end development, and experience managing design systems, often supported by a relevant degree in design, HCI, or computer science. Familiarity with design tools like Figma, Sketch, and version control systems, as well as knowledge of CSS frameworks and component libraries, is essential. Strong communication, leadership, and stakeholder management skills help drive adoption and collaboration across teams. These abilities ensure a consistent and scalable design language that accelerates development and delivers cohesive user experiences.

The Role

The Payload Systems Engineer is responsible for designing advanced payloads for satellite systems across all orbits.



Key Responsibilities

  • Design advanced communication payloads for satellite systems across all orbits (LEO, MEO, GEO)
  • Contribute to the design, analysis, integration, and validation of satellite systems for nextโ€‘generation missions
  • Work across payload design, system performance analysis, assembly, integration and testing, and mission operations
  • Support design trades involving payload capacity, system mass, power optimization, spectral resources, and overall mission-level performance
  • Work closely with software, mechanical, thermal, and electrical engineering to optimize the satellite resources
  • Analyze mission requirements and translate them into technical specifications, system-level requirements, and engineering constraints
  • Optimize the performance of satellite systems by maximizing payload efficiency, minimizing satellite mass and volume, and improving power use and duty cycles
  • Build and execute simulations and models to evaluate payload performance under various operating and environmental conditions
  • Support Assembly, Integration, and Test (AIT) activities including test plans, procedures, troubleshooting, performance validation, and verification strategies to validate systems and payload performance
  • Support major reviews (SRR, PDR, CDR, MRR, TRR)
  • Engage directly with hardware suppliers and evaluate hardware for payload architecture
  • Support hardware procurement
  • Participate in meetings and design reviews
  • Responsible for overall communication subsystem
  • Develop and maintain analysis tools across the program execution
  • Develop payload block diagrams
  • Requirements flow down
  • Compute Link Budget Analysis
  • Translate mission and system requirements into subsystem and unit-level technical requirements, interfaces, and verification criteria

Qualifications & Experience

  • Bachelor of Science degree in Electrical Engineering or related degree
  • MSEE in related field desired, but not required
  • Minimum of 2 years of experience in a similar role
  • RF Communications Engineering/Payload Systems background
  • Payload Experience โ€“ ideally communication payloads
  • Payload Analysis and Budgets: EIRP, G/T, Conversion factors, Signal level budgets, group delay, frequency response and more
  • Knowledgeable with payload thermal and power aspects
  • Active and passive communication payload hardware knowledge: HPA, LNA, Receivers, MRO, MLO, Converters, Filters, antenna subsystem(reflector based and DRAs)
  • Familiar with digital payloads, (digital channelizer with or without beamforming)
  • Strong understanding of satellite subsystems, particularly RF payloads, and spacecraft platforms
  • Handsโ€‘on experience in system modelling, simulation, and performance assessment
  • Experience with requirements development, ConOps definition, and system-level design processes
  • Solid analytical and problemโ€‘solving skills, with the ability to interpret complex system interactions
  • Experience in working in satellite manufacturing environment preferred
  • Experienced in digital payloads, (digital channelizer with or without beamforming), and/or regenerative payloads preferred
  • Experience with Phased/Active Arrays and Optical communication preferred
  • Familiarity with digital payloads, phased arrays, and advanced communication system architectures preferred
  • Experience with environmental testing, satellite integration, or inโ€‘orbit payload testing preferred
  • Proficiency in Python, MATLAB, STK or other scripting languages for simulation, analysis, and tool development preferred

Vitesse Systems, LLC performs work controlled by the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R) and Export Administration Regulations (EAR). These statutes require the protection of technical data and products. The regulations require that such data not be disclosed in written, oral, or visual form to any foreign national without prior export authorization from the Department of State. A foreign national is defined by the U.S. Government under EAR 734.2(b)(2)(ii) and 8 USC 110 (a)(20) as one who:

  • Is not a United States citizen
  • Is not lawfully admitted for permanent residence in the U.S.
  • Does not have politically protected status (embassy, refugee, or asylum)
